Title: Innovations of Nicholas Dartnell in Gas Sensing Technology

Introduction

Nicholas Dartnell is a notable inventor based in Cambridgeshire, GB. He has made significant contributions to the field of gas sensing technology, holding a total of 4 patents. His work focuses on developing advanced gas sensor systems that can accurately detect and differentiate between various gases in different environments.

Latest Patents

One of Nicholas Dartnell's latest patents is a semiconductor gas sensor and method for sensing two or more gases using contact resistance and sheet resistance. This innovative gas sensor system is designed to measure a plurality of gases in an environment. The system comprises multiple gas sensors, each featuring a pair of electrodes separated by a semiconducting material. The resistivity of the semiconducting material changes in the presence of a first gas, while the contact resistivity between the electrodes and the semiconducting material changes in the presence of a second gas. By measuring the total resistivity of each gas sensor, the system can determine the presence and concentration of both gases.

Another significant patent is a gas sensor system that includes at least one first field effect transistor (FET) and at least one second FET, each with distinct source and drain electrodes. The different responses of these FETs to gases in the environment allow for the differentiation between gases, such as 1-methylcyclopropene and ethylene, particularly in locations where fruit is stored.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Nicholas Dartnell has worked with prominent companies in the field, including Sumitomo Chemical Company, Limited and Cambridge Display Technology Limited. His experience in these organizations has contributed to his expertise in gas sensing technologies and innovations.

Collaborations

Nicholas has collaborated with notable individuals in his field, including Simon Goddard and Christopher Newsome. These collaborations have further enhanced his work and contributions to gas sensing technology.
